The local area
Kirkby became popular as an overspill area of Liverpool during the middle of the 20th century, as the centre of the city less than nine miles from Kirkby. There are trains that reach Liverpool Central station in less than 20 minutes, making Kirkby a great place to live if you want to commute to the city.
Local towns like Bootle, Crosby, St Helens and Bebington are easily accessible by road and the town has great access to the M57 motorway. This passes right by Kirkby and heads south to the M62 which can be used to get to Manchester. When you want to go on holiday, Liverpool John Lennon Airport is less than 15 miles away.
There’s a good selection of schools in the area for families with children to take into account, including Eastcroft Park Primary, Kirkby CofE and Northwood Primary. For older children, Kirkby High School provides secondary education, while All Saints Catholic High School has its own sixth form. For further education facilities, try Knowsley Community College, which has a centre based in the heart of Kirkby.
